|
|
@@ -136,11 +136,8 @@ const logger = createLogger(is_debug)
|
|
|
var xiaomi = new Xiaomi(username, password, $.step, userType)
|
|
|
var code = await xiaomi.getCode()
|
|
|
var { loginToken, userId } = await xiaomi.doLogin(code)
|
|
|
- logger.debug(`xxxxxx1`)
|
|
|
var appToken = await xiaomi.getAppToken(loginToken)
|
|
|
- logger.debug(`xxxxxx2`)
|
|
|
await xiaomi.doStep(appToken, userId)
|
|
|
- logger.debug(`xxxxxx3`)
|
|
|
} catch (e) {
|
|
|
await SendNotify($.name, '', `❌账号: ${user} 任务执行失败, 请打开调试模式查看日志!`)
|
|
|
logger.error(`[${user}] 执行失败`, e)
|
|
|
@@ -188,11 +185,17 @@ function Xiaomi(user, pwd, step, userType) {
|
|
|
}
|
|
|
// 获取淘宝时间 -- success
|
|
|
async getTimeByTaobao() {
|
|
|
- const url = 'http://api.m.taobao.com/rest/api3.do?api=mtop.common.getTimestamp'
|
|
|
+ // const url = 'http://api.m.taobao.com/rest/api3.do?api=mtop.common.getTimestamp'
|
|
|
+ // const {
|
|
|
+ // data: { t: time }
|
|
|
+ // } = await fetchData(url)
|
|
|
+ // return time
|
|
|
+ const url = 'https://quan.suning.com/getSysTime.do'
|
|
|
const {
|
|
|
- data: { t: time }
|
|
|
+ sysTime1: timeSec,
|
|
|
+ sysTime2: timeStr
|
|
|
} = await fetchData(url)
|
|
|
- return time
|
|
|
+ return timeSec
|
|
|
}
|
|
|
// 登录参数 -- success
|
|
|
async getCode() {
|